Quick Verdict
The Aspen Pet Mighty Link Light Weight Dog Collar has a mixed reception. Some owners find it effective for control, while others complain about poor quality. It's functional but has durability concerns.

Common Questions
Is this collar suitable for medium to large dogs?
Yes, it works well for medium to large dogs, especially in crowded environments.
How durable is the Aspen Pet Mighty Link Collar?
Durability is a concern. Some users report it thinning out after a few months of use.
